J Tender G. V. Parks V Hageman Board of Education The Board of Education has the responsibility of providing adequate school opportunities for the youth of the community. The community looks to Board members, as elected representatives of the school dis- trict, tor leadership and service in the development and maintenance of the type of educational program which will best serve the interests of youth. While public education is a state responsibility, school district policy within the framework ot state laws is delegated to the local Board of Education. Board members give much time and energy to their important role in the educational program. V. Glorioso 11 J. B. Weintraub

Evans, Superintendent of Schools, is the chief executive otticer for the Board of Education, He administers the program ot public education in ac- cordance with the adopted policies of the Board and other regulations by the state. He presents needed information to the Board for study and proposes school policies tor the Board's deliber- ation. Dr. Evans received his Bachelor Degree from Rio Grande College and the Master of Arts and Doctor ot Phi- losophy Degree from Ohio State University. Secondary Director J. F. Calta, Director ot Secondary Education, has the responsibility ot in- structional supervision ot the junior and senior high schools. His vvorlc involves the improvement ot curriculum, the improve- ment of classroom instruction, and the acquisition of books, supplies, and equip- ment tor secondary schools. ln addition to these duties he is available to assist principals in building organization and other administrative problems pertaining to the secondary schools. Principal To the student body, This school year will long be remembered. Not only was '57-'58 in the Geophysical Year, but the Russians really stunned Americans with the surprise launching of their satellites. Most good citizens will want to accept their responsibility as citizens. Too often we think of our privileges and rights and forget the duties that go along with our heritage. Perhaps, from this year on, young people as well as adults, will take school work more seriously. Perhaps, students will strive to excel, to get good grades in school, to learn. We must accept that it will take knowledge as well as material things to compete with the Russians, or we will lose our American way of life. The staff of Lorain High School ioin me in my hope and belief that the pupils of this school will accept their duty and rise to the challenge. Since our first l..l-l.S. commencement in l879, many of our graduates, by their accomplish- ments, have brought honor to Lorain.
